What Is Razo 20 Mg?
Razo 20 Mg is an enteric-coated delayed-release tablet containing rabeprazole sodium, a substituted benzimidazole compound that belongs to the proton pump inhibitor class. It is engineered to block the final phase of gastric acid production within the stomach’s parietal cells.
Rabeprazole has a high pKa (~5.0), allowing it to convert into its active sulfenamide form rapidly, even in less acidic environments. Because of this property, Razo 20 Mg achieves rapid onset of antisecretory activity from the very first dose compared to older traditional PPIs.
Razo 20 Mg is indicated for the acute relief and mucosal healing of acid-peptic disorders, maintenance therapy in erosive esophagitis, and as a component of combination antibiotic regimens for Helicobacter pylori clearance.

How Does Razo 20 Mg Work?
Gastric parietal cells generate hydrochloric acid through the active proton pumping mechanism of the H+/K+ ATPase enzyme system located at the secretory surface.
- Rapid Acid Activation: After absorption from the small intestine, rabeprazole concentrates in the acidic canaliculi of parietal cells, where it protonates into an active sulfenamide metabolite.
- Covalent Enzyme Binding: The active form binds covalently to critical cysteine residues on the luminal subunit of the H+/K+ ATPase enzyme, inactivating the proton pump.
- Comprehensive Acid Blockade: Because it halts the final common conduit of acid secretion, Razo suppresses both resting (basal) and meal-stimulated gastric acid output irrespective of chemical stimulus (histamine, gastrin, or acetylcholine).
Rabeprazole also exhibits a largely non-enzymatic clearance pathway with minimal CYP2C19 dependency, ensuring consistent acid suppression across patients with varying genetic metabolic rates.
What Is Razo 20 Mg Used For?
Razo 20 Mg is clinically approved for the treatment, healing, and maintenance of several acid-peptic conditions in adults and adolescents aged 12 years and older:
- Healing of Erosive GERD: Treatment of mucosal erosion, ulceration, and inflammation of the esophagus (4 to 8 weeks).
- Maintenance of Healed GERD: Long-term reduction of relapse rates of daytime and nighttime heartburn symptoms.
- Symptomatic GERD: Relief of burning retrosternal pain, acid regurgitation, and postprandial dyspepsia in adults and adolescents.
- Active Duodenal Ulcers: Short-term healing and symptomatic relief of active duodenal ulcerations (up to 4 weeks).
- Helicobacter pylori Eradication: 7-day triple therapy combined with clarithromycin and amoxicillin to clear bacterial infection and prevent ulcer recurrence.
- Pathological Hypersecretory Disorders: Long-term suppression of excess acid production in conditions including Zollinger-Ellison syndrome.
Relief of symptoms does not eliminate the possibility of underlying gastric malignancy; appropriate clinical evaluation should be performed if warning signs occur.

Razo 20 Mg Dosage and Administration
Dosage guidelines for Razo 20 Mg vary according to the clinical indication:
- Erosive GERD (Healing): 20 Mg once daily for 4 to 8 weeks. An additional 8-week course may be considered if healing is incomplete.
- Maintenance of Healed GERD: 20 Mg once daily (studied up to 12 months).
- Symptomatic GERD: 20 Mg once daily for 4 weeks in adults (and up to 8 weeks in adolescents aged 12 and older).
- Duodenal Ulcers: 20 Mg once daily taken in the morning after breakfast for up to 4 weeks.
- H. pylori Eradication: 20 Mg twice daily with meals for 7 days in combination with amoxicillin (1000 mg) and clarithromycin (500 mg).
- Zollinger-Ellison Syndrome: Starting dose is 60 Mg once daily, adjusted upward based on clinical response up to 100 Mg once daily or 60 Mg twice daily.
Swallow Razo tablets whole with a glass of water. Do not chew, crush, or split the tablets, as damaging the enteric coating exposes the active rabeprazole to gastric acid breakdown.

For duodenal ulcers, take Razo after the morning meal. For H. pylori regimens, take with meals. For general GERD and heartburn indications, Razo can be taken with or without food.
Razo 20 Mg (Rabeprazole) vs Pantoprazole 40 Mg
While both medications are second-generation proton pump inhibitors, their activation speeds, metabolic clearance pathways, and enzymatic affinities differ:
| Parameter | Razo 20 Mg (Rabeprazole) | Pantoprazole Tablets 40 Mg |
|---|---|---|
| Molecular Activation Rate | Fast (High pKa ~5.0; rapid activation) | Moderate (pKa ~3.9; activated in high acidity) |
| Metabolic Pathway | Non-enzymatic reduction (thioether) + minor CYP | Hepatic CYP2C19 & CYP3A4 oxidation |
| Impact of CYP2C19 Genotype | Minimal variation across poor/extensive metabolizers | Moderate influence on elimination kinetics |
| Onset of Symptom Relief | Rapid relief starting on Day 1 | Gradual onset, optimal control in 2 to 3 days |
| Food Effect on Timing | Can be taken with or without food for most uses | Ideally taken 30–60 min before breakfast |
Rabeprazole provides faster initial acid control and less pharmacokinetic variability across different genetic metabolizer profiles, whereas pantoprazole offers well-characterized long-term data in intensive polypharmacy regimens.
Who Should Not Take Razo 20 Mg?
Razo 20 Mg is contraindicated in patients with specific hypersensitivities or drug interactions:
- Known hypersensitivity to rabeprazole sodium, substituted benzimidazoles, or any tablet excipients (can cause anaphylaxis, angioedema, or urticaria)
- Concurrent administration with rilpivirine-containing antiretroviral medications (PPIs significantly lower rilpivirine plasma concentrations, leading to virological failure)
- History of acute interstitial nephritis induced by previous proton pump inhibitor therapy
- Children under 12 years of age (safety and effectiveness have not been established)
Caution is advised in patients with severe hepatic impairment, osteoporosis risk, or ongoing treatment with medications dependent on gastric acidity.

Possible Side Effects of Razo 20 Mg
Rabeprazole is generally well tolerated. Most reported adverse reactions are mild and transient:
- Common Reactions: Headache, diarrhea, nausea, abdominal discomfort, flatulence, and constipation.
- Respiratory/Infectious: Pharyngitis, cough, and non-specific flu-like symptoms.
- Kidney Complications: Acute tubulointerstitial nephritis, which may occur at any time during therapy.
- Intestinal Infections: Increased susceptibility to Clostridioides difficile-associated diarrhea due to altered gastric microflora.
- Skin Manifestations: Cutaneous lupus erythematosus (CLE) or exacerbation of systemic lupus erythematosus (SLE).
Seek immediate medical assistance if severe watery diarrhea, reduced urine output, unexplained skin rashes, or signs of anaphylaxis occur.

Razo 20 Mg Drug Interactions
Tell your prescribing clinician about all prescription drugs, over-the-counter medications, and supplements you are using:
pH-Dependent Bioavailability: By elevating intragastric pH, rabeprazole decreases the absorption of ketoconazole, itraconazole, iron salts, and certain kinase inhibitors, while potentially increasing systemic levels of digoxin.
Warfarin: Concurrent use of PPIs with warfarin can lead to elevated INR and prothrombin times; regular INR monitoring is recommended.
Methotrexate: Concomitant use with PPIs (especially high-dose regimens) may elevate and prolong serum levels of methotrexate and its metabolite, increasing potential toxicity.
Clopidogrel: Because rabeprazole is primarily cleared via non-enzymatic reduction to a thioether compound rather than extensive CYP2C19 metabolism, it exhibits minimal antiplatelet interference with clopidogrel compared to omeprazole.

Hepatic Metabolism and Clearance
Rabeprazole undergoes extensive transformation, largely through non-enzymatic conversion to rabeprazole-thioether, alongside CYP3A4 and CYP2C19 pathways. Metabolites are excreted mainly in urine (~90%).
In patients with mild to moderate hepatic impairment, no dosage adjustment is typically required. In patients with severe hepatic impairment, elimination half-life is prolonged (~2- to 3-fold increase in AUC). Caution and clinical monitoring are advised when initiating Razo in severe liver disease.

Long-Term Safety Considerations
When proton pump inhibitors are used over prolonged durations (> 1 year), several monitoring points are clinically relevant:
- Bone Fractures: High-dose or long-term therapy may be associated with an increased risk of osteoporosis-related fractures of the hip, wrist, or spine.
- Hypomagnesemia: Clinically significant low magnesium levels have been reported with extended PPI therapy; periodic electrolyte checks are advisable.
- Vitamin B12 Malabsorption: Prolonged, deep acid suppression can impair cyanocobalamin absorption from dietary proteins.
- Fundic Gland Polyps: Long-term use can increase the incidence of benign fundic gland polyps, which typically resolve upon treatment cessation.
Clinicians should aim to prescribe Razo at the lowest effective dose for the shortest duration necessary for the clinical indication.

Frequently Asked Questions About Razo 20 Mg
1. How quickly does Razo 20 Mg work compared to other PPIs?
Rabeprazole has a high pKa (~5.0), meaning it converts to its active acid-inhibiting form quickly within the stomach’s parietal cells. Many patients experience notable acid suppression and heartburn relief starting from the first dose on Day 1.

2. Can Razo 20 Mg tablets be crushed or split?
No. Razo tablets are enteric-coated to protect the acid-sensitive rabeprazole molecule from destruction in the stomach. Tablets must be swallowed whole with water. Crushing or chewing destroys this protective layer and negates effectiveness.
3. Should I take Razo 20 Mg with or without food?
For GERD and general heartburn symptoms, Razo can be taken with or without food. However, when treating active duodenal ulcers, taking it in the morning after breakfast is recommended. For H. pylori eradication regimens, it should be taken with meals alongside the prescribed antibiotics.
